Definition
An ALM Manager is a generic job profile template that can be used as the starting point for defining a more specific risk management job profile. This is NOT a template for a job vacancy advertisement as it does not include any specifics about any particular type of hiring entity.

Roles and Responsibilities
An Asset and Liability Manager may have a broad description of tasks with the precise composition depending on the organization / business model. For financial institutions, an ALM Manager may encompass managing risks and exposures in some of the following areas:
- Interest Rate Risk
- Liquidity Risk
- Currency Risk (FX Risk)
- Optionality Risk (risks associated with contractually embedded options such as Prepayment Risk)
